Transaction 3069d9528577c4e24327dde17d4ba303fbd72f24cb2305fdc91cc304f4c398bd

1 Input
2 Outputs
  • 3069d9528577c4e24327dde17d4ba303fbd72f24cb2305fdc91cc304f4c398bd:0
  • value  11528694
    address  1E2tTCj9dzwNAXyWKT5m18kbwDF5Z83ojV
  • 3069d9528577c4e24327dde17d4ba303fbd72f24cb2305fdc91cc304f4c398bd:1
  • value  496525
    address  3FMWfMdaDGbkcQPFMZjGc4eqTHAZ8VHMGY